Brighton, England vs Im Poliny Osipenko Climate & Distance Between

Russia flag
  • The distance between Brighton, England, Uk and Im Poliny Osipenko, Russia is approximately 7,837 km or 4,870 mi.
  • To reach Brighton, England in this distance one would set out from Im Poliny Osipenko bearing 332.6°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Brighton, England bearing 206.4° or SSW .
  • Brighton, England has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Im Poliny Osipenko has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with dry winters (Dwb).
  • Brighton, England is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Im Poliny Osipenko is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 13.5 °C (24.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 33.4 °C (60.1°F) less in Brighton, England.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 328.8 mm (12.9 in) more which is equivalent to 328.8 l/m² (8.07 US gal/ft²) or 3,288,000 l/ha (351,509 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.6° higher in Brighton, England than in Im Poliny Osipenko.
